Libor’s Independence Exercises

07.18.11 by Patrick 2 Comments

Here are some neat independence ideas from Libor Hadrava of Axiom Music School.

  1. Table of Time: Changing subdivisions with the hands over a 3/16 pattern with the feet.
  2. Table of Time – Paradiddles: Same as above but overlaying the paradiddle pattern with the hands
  3. Independence Plus Counting: Feet play RLRR LRLL, hands play RRR LLL, count aloud a third grouping!
